## Pickwise optimizer — quick orientation

Welcome aboard. Pickwise recomputes pick-lists for the Dunmore warehouse every 90 seconds; if it falls behind, pickers see stale routes and throughput tanks fast. First thing to check is the solver queue depth — anything over 200 means the optimizer is choking, usually on a bad zone map upload. Restarting the solver pod is safe; it's stateless and replays from the event log. Before touching anything else, confirm the service is running with the expected configuration shown here.

service settings:
PRAIX_LOG_LEVEL=error
PRAIX_METRICS_HOST=metrics.praix.qorvelcorp.corp
PRAIX_POOL_SIZE=16

Handover note — Crumbwheel order cutoffs.

Welcome aboard. The bakery cutoff rule in Crumbwheel closes same-day orders at 14:00 local to each storefront, not UTC — this has bitten us twice. Holiday overrides live in the calendar service and take precedence silently, so always check there first when a cutoff looks wrong. To unlock the calendar service's admin console after a restart, enter the recovery passphrase below.

vault phrase of bagap-bahaf = silion-pelox-sorox-casdor-quenwyn-fraax-eliox-praael-kelion-quenvan-kasox-rusael-norius-belvan

### Bloom Filter Front for Keldstore

To cut pointless disk reads on Keldstore lookups, we place a bloom filter in front of each shard. Misses are answered in memory; a filter hit still requires a real read, so false positives cost us one wasted seek each. We size the filter per shard at load time and rebuild it during compaction rather than mutating in place, which keeps the hot path lock-free. Sizing trades memory against false-positive rate. The chosen tuning constants are listed below.

constants for bawif-kawif:
QUOTAS = {
    "ulaael": 5,
    "holael": 10,
}